Turbot which belong to the family Scophthalmidae, is a seawater
(marine) fish found primarily throughout the Mediterranean, Baltic Sea,
Black Sea and the North Atlantic. A large diamond shaped flatfish, it can reach
sizes of or up to 17kg/40lb. They are also farmed in countries such as
Spain, Chile and China. Classed as an
"White" fish, Turbot is highly prized for its delicate flavour
and bright white firm flesh and is considered by many to be the king of all the
flatfish. So much so that special "turbot kettles" were manufactured to enable
cooks in upper class households to cook large specimens whole for dinner
parties.
Suitable substitutes for Turbot include Halibut, Dover Sole.
